%X A strain of Aspergillus flauut TH5007 producing L-malic acid was isolatedand selected after a series of subsequent mutation. Various fermentation conditions werestudied to obtain process optimization, characterized by the direct fermentation with thehydrolysate from sweet potato powder. The concentration of L-malic acid in the fermentedbroth can reached to about 6.0%. Among the total acids in the ferinentation broth, Thecontent of malic acid amounts to above 72%. Citric aicd predominanted in the other organicacids than malic acid. The content of fumaric acid can be controlled below 0.02%. Produ-ction of L-malic acid with the fed-batch process is better than that with the batch process.
